Interpretation of results and medical responsibility
Tests performed by Biodiv Laboratorios are intended to provide analytical information obtained through technical and scientific processes, which must be interpreted by a properly qualified healthcare professional.
Laboratory results do not, by themselves, constitute a medical diagnosis, nor do they replace the clinical evaluation performed by a treating physician.
Biodiv Laboratorios is not responsible for incorrect interpretations, personal conclusions, self-diagnoses, or medical decisions made by the patient or other individuals who are not qualified healthcare professionals.
Likewise, the reference values included in the reports are provided for guidance purposes only and may vary depending on clinical factors, physiological conditions, age, sex, medical history, and other criteria that must be evaluated by the treating physician.
The patient acknowledges that the final interpretation of the results and any medical decisions arising from them are the sole responsibility of the healthcare professional managing their clinical care.
